Home excavation services involve the process of digging, leveling, and preparing land around a property to meet specific construction or landscaping needs. This work typically includes removing soil or debris, grading the terrain for proper drainage, and creating a stable foundation for future projects such as building a new home, installing a driveway, or setting up a backyard patio.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ment to ensure the work is done efficiently and accurately, helping homeowners achieve a safe and functional outdoor space.
These services are often sought when homeowners face issues like poor drainage, uneven land, or the need for space to accommodate new structures. For example, if a property has standing water after heavy rains, excavation can help redirect water flow and prevent flooding. Similarly, properties with sloped or uneven terrain may require grading to create level areas suitable for construction or landscaping. Excavation work can also prepare the ground for installing underground utilities or septic systems, making it a crucial step in many property improvement projects.

The overview below groups typical Home Excavation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cookeville, TN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or excavation tasks like trenching or small foundation adjustments range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on soil conditions and project scope.
Medium Projects - Larger landscaping or driveway excavation projects generally cost between $1,000 and $3,500. These projects are common and vary based on the size of the area and site accessibility.
Full Excavation or Site Prep - Complete site clearing or significant groundwork can range from $3,500 to $8,000, with some complex projects reaching higher. Many local contractors handle jobs in this range, depending on project complexity.
Large-Scale or Custom Jobs - Extensive excavation work, such as large foundation removal or major grading, can exceed $8,000 and reach $15,000+ in certain cases. Fewer projects fall into this highest tier, typically reserved for complex or commercial jobs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
